Introduction to the job
ASML US, including its affiliates and subsidiaries, brings together the most creative minds in science and technology to develop lithography machines that are key to producing faster, cheaper, more energy-efficient microchips. We design, develop, integrate, market and service these advanced machines, which enable our customers - the world's leading chipmakers - to reduce the size and increase the functionality of their microchips, which in turn leads to smaller, more powerful consumer electronics. Our headquarters are in Veldhoven, Netherlands, and we have 18 office locations around the United States including main offices in Chandler, Arizona, San Jose and San Diego, California, Wilton, Connecticut, and Hillsboro, Oregon.
Role and responsibilities
ASML/HMI brings together the most creative minds in science and technology to develop lithography & metrology machines, as well as computational lithography & control software products. HMI metrology application design engineer is responsible for product development by high resolution e-beam systems, providing holistic control solution for advanced nodes in semi-conductor industries.
This position may require access to controlled technology, as defined in the Export Administration Regulations (15 C.F.R. 730, et seq.). Qualified candidates must be legally authorized to access such controlled technology prior to beginning work. Business demands may require the Company to proceed with candidates who are immediately eligible to access controlled technology.
Education and experience
Master and above in Electrical Engineering, Physics, Mechanical engineering, Material Science or Chemical Engineering.
Experiences
Minimum 2 year relevant experiences of semi-conductor process optimization, data science for process improvement, ebeam technology, optical metrology and/or material characterization.
Hands-on experience on CD/overlay metrology or photo-lithography is plus.
Script level programming skills is plus, including Matlab, Python or C++.
Able to operate data visualization tool, including excel Marco, JMP or Spotfire.
Perform feasibility studies to access performance of e-beam metrology system functionalities, defining metrology application product specification.
Be responsible for functional design and performance evaluation on application products, collaborating with different ASML sectors on holistic solution for process control.
Generate and maintain script tooling for design of experiments, enabling efficient performance evaluation and trouble-shooting.
Engage with worldwide semi-conductor customers, in charge of new product introduction and early product evaluation.
Bring customer use cases learning back to product development, driving solution for metrology performance improvement.
10-20% international travel is required.
